Pa. Man Arrives In Philly In Round-The-World Charity Run

A 33-year old man running around the world for charity stopped at the Liberty Bell in Philadelphia today.

It's been a tough year for Alex Stoy.  He lost his mother, several friends, and his dream job, so he decided it was time for a big change.

So now he's running 30 kilometers and doing 30 yoga exercises in 30 different cities to raise awareness and money for needy kids and mental health facilities.

His local run was a homecoming:

"I grew up in the Poconos, but never did the sights in Philly.  So I met my sister's friend here and we ran this morning to check out the sights, then I ran with my brother at Penn's Landing.

"It's different than what I remember from ten, twelve years ago -- it's a lot cleaner.  It's awesome.  It's really cool to be back here."
